Please see attached chart for specifications on MT PRO C&M irons and MT PRO "DW" Wedges.

MT PRO C&M Irons:

Standard Finish Option: Satin Chrome on 1025 Carbon Steel…considering special order options for Bright Chrome and Gunmetal

 

Standard Shaft Options: Nippon NS1150GH, Dynamic Gold…many other custom order shafts will be available

 

Standard Grip Option: MacGregor Golf Pride DD2 (Black/Red)…many other custom order grips will be available

 

MT PRO "DW" Wedges:

Standard Finish Option: Satin Chrome or Gunmetal on 1025 Carbon Steel…considering special order option of Bright Chrome

 

Standard Shaft Options: Dynamic Gold…many other custom order shafts will be available.

 

Standard Grip Option: MacGregor Golf Pride DD2 (Black/Red)…many other custom order grips will be available.

Neither...it will be a DCT insert, but with similar feel to HSM. DCT offers game improvement insert technology to the putter category. DCT self corrects energy loss on putts struck off center. So in other words...if you stike a putt up to a half inch towards the toe or heel, it will roll the same distance as if you hit the sweet spot. On long putts this trait becomes extremely valuable. We have a patent to cover this technology and it is USGA approved.

My sales rep sent me these few extra pics for their new 2008 clubs.

 

Some extra info

 

The MT "PRO-M" irons offer professional and better amateurs a classic Muscle Back design.

MT PRO-M iron F&B's:

 

Compact profiles, Flatter Soles, and impact zone positioned weighting

Maximizes player's workability to shape their shots and optimize trajectory.

Forged from soft 1025 carbon steel

CNC flat milled faces, CNC Milled square grooves and CNC milled back design

True Temper Dynamic Gold Steel Shafts
